Transaction 882f41e37361abda4255e8901086021fe832950dc2dce81346cf5f26fcc40541

1 Input
2 Outputs
  • 882f41e37361abda4255e8901086021fe832950dc2dce81346cf5f26fcc40541:0
  • value  653598
    address  3KSpeBZCTjf6x1rbvpe67epsxGkUjVb482
  • 882f41e37361abda4255e8901086021fe832950dc2dce81346cf5f26fcc40541:1
  • value  13942245
    address  3C63qx6UyCSji9GDTPFu3JFTSnLKtZo91r